Output 3390d61f864cccf78ce9b98f0c2f5bff9bbcded5856a488b966f091df57a434f:6

value
336476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76b72795dcc007f220fefed7a45f8f6a2c768d94 OP_EQUAL
address
3CWj4zB4dniaXgXBE81udqgzKmA1b6hc2e
transaction
3390d61f864cccf78ce9b98f0c2f5bff9bbcded5856a488b966f091df57a434f
spent
true